Ingredients
– 1 ¾ cups all-purpose flour forms the cookie dough structure after heat-treating
– ¾ cup unsalted butter, softened adds richness and helps the dip stay smooth
– ¾ cup light brown sugar brings caramel flavor and chew
– ½ cup granulated sugar balances sweetness and supports texture
– 2 teaspoons vanilla extract rounds out the classic cookie flavor
– ½ teaspoon fine sea salt makes the sweets taste more “cookie-like”
– 1 cup mini chocolate chips adds chocolate pockets in every bite
– ¾ cup peanut butter chips creates creamy peanut butter flavor throughout
– ¾ cup toffee bits gives crunch and sweet buttery toffee notes
– 1 to 3 tablespoons milk (start with 1 tablespoon) adjusts the dough so it is scoopable and holds its shape
– Red, white, and blue candies for decoration forms the flag pattern
Instructions
1-First Step: Heat-treat the flour. Spread the flour on a baking sheet and bake at 350°F for 5 minutes. Then let it cool completely.
2-Second Step: In a large bowl, cream the unsalted butter, light brown sugar, and granulated sugar together for about 3 minutes, until light and fluffy.
3-Third Step: Add vanilla extract and fine sea salt. Mix until combined.
4-Fourth Step: Gradually mix in the cooled flour until combined. You should see no dry flour streaks.
5-Fifth Step: Stir in mini chocolate chips, peanut butter chips, and toffee bits.
6-Sixth Step: Add milk slowly, starting with 1 tablespoon. Mix until the dough holds its shape but allows candies to stick. Usually, that is about 1 tablespoon, but you can use 1 to 3 tablespoons total depending on your texture.
7-Seventh Step: Shape the dough into a rectangle on a flat surface (like a cutting board or parchment-lined tray).
8-Eighth Step: Press red, white, and blue candies onto the dough in a flag pattern. Start from the bottom row and work upwards, including sides if desired.
9-Final Step: Serve immediately, or refrigerate without candies if storing for more than 2 hours. If refrigerated, allow the dip to soften at room temperature for 15 to 20 minutes before serving.

🔥 Always heat-treat flour first to make it safe for eating raw.
🥛 Add milk gradually for perfect dip consistency – not too dry or runny.
🎨 Decorate flag just before serving to keep candies vibrant and colors true.
